ABSTRACT:
A technique is provided for re-routing telecommunications traffic that is originally destined for passage between an inter-exchange carrier, via a first gateway POP (18) at a first local exchange (12.sub.1), and a second local exchange (12.sub.5) that is dead-ended because of a single local trunk (16) coupling it to the first exchange. Such re-routing is accomplished, in the event of a failure of the local trunk (16), by providing an optical switch (24) at the dead-ended local exchange (12.sub.5) for routing traffic onto and off an express traffic link (20) passing through the exchange between the first gateway POP (18) and a second gateway POP (18) of the inter-exchange carrier. In this way, traffic can be routed by the inter-exchange carrier, via its second gateway POP (18), to and from the dead-ended local exchange (12.sub.5) without the need to physically restore the failed local trunk (16).
